A shipping container has a rectangular base with dimensions 8 feet by 40 feet. The volume of the shipping container is 3,040 cubic feet. How tall is the shipping container?

Let h be the height of the shipping container in feet. The volume of a rectangular box can be found by multiplying the length, width, and height of the box. Using this formula, we can set up an equation to solve for h:

8 x 40 x h = 3,040

Simplifying this equation, we get:

320h = 3,040

Dividing both sides by 320, we get:

h = 3,040 / 320

h = 9.5

Therefore, the height of the shipping container is 9.5 feet.
